Como fazer o neofetch mostrar uma imagem em vez da logo ASCII da distro
Dica publicada em Linux / Configuração
Como fazer o neofetch mostrar uma imagem em vez da logo ASCII da distro
Primeiramente você deve ter em mente que nem todo emulador de terminal é capaz de mostrar imagens. Testei no Konsole e no terminal do XFCE, e não funcionou em nenhum dos dois, por isso recomendo que você use o urxvt caso queira testar essa dica.
Instale o w3m, é ele que usaremos para mostrar a imagem:
sudo apt install w3m
Caso use arch:
sudo pacman -S w3m
Agora basta digitar o comando "neofetch --w3m" mais o caminho da sua imagem. Exemplo:
neofetch --w3m Imagens/imagem.png
Você pode usar imagens png, jpg ou webp.
Caso você queria que neofetch inicie sempre mostrando sua imagem, ache a linha "# Image Backend", e no:
image_backend="ascii"
troque o "ascii" por "w3m", assim:
Agora ache a linha "# Image Source", e no:
image_source="auto"
substitua o "auto" pelo caminho da sua imagem. Exemplo:
Instale o w3m, é ele que usaremos para mostrar a imagem:
sudo apt install w3m
Caso use arch:
sudo pacman -S w3m
Agora basta digitar o comando "neofetch --w3m" mais o caminho da sua imagem. Exemplo:
neofetch --w3m Imagens/imagem.png
Você pode usar imagens png, jpg ou webp.
Caso você queria que neofetch inicie sempre mostrando sua imagem, ache a linha "# Image Backend", e no:
image_backend="ascii"
troque o "ascii" por "w3m", assim:
image_backend="w3m"
Agora ache a linha "# Image Source", e no:
image_source="auto"
substitua o "auto" pelo caminho da sua imagem. Exemplo:
image_source="Imagens/imagem.png"
Muito bom. Creio que o lance de funcionalidade também depende de certas configurações no emulador de terminal, em alguns casos. Claro que o Konsole é meio chatinho para isso. Realmente as vezes, não tem como mesmo. Mas com o xterm também deve funcionar.
___________________________________________________________